Link an Image to a field
Hello !
I have a Field "Item" on a report and I would like to show the image of the item. There is not the path on a field, but the path is still the same only the name of the item change. So what I want is to add an Image control on the report and write the information : Image1.Picture = "C:\My pictures\" & [item] & ".jpg" That is about what I would ... in that way the image should show the item on a picture. Someone could explain me how to obtain that result ? Thank you. |

Link an Image to a field
Assuming the image file "C:\My pictures\" & [item] & ".jpg" exists then
simply add your line of code to the Print event of the section where the value of the field [Item] changes. However, if your folder is supposed to refer to the user's Windows "My Pictures" folder then it won't work. You'll need code to find this folder as it will be different for each user. Link an Image to a field
Hello!
I have risolved ! I have done a new report and it works using the event "format" Private Sub Détail_Format(Cancel As Integer, FormatCount As Integer) Dim strPath As String, strImage As String strImage = [item] strPath = "c:\my pictures\" & strImage & ".jpg" On Error Resume Next Me.Image3.Picture = strPath End Sub Thanks for the help ! |
